Decoding the popularity of ML among students and professional 

Among the wave of high-paying tech jobs, there are several reasons for the growing interest in machine learning, including: 

  1. High Demand: As the world becomes more data-driven, the demand for professionals with expertise in machine learning has grown. Companies across all industries are looking for people who can leverage machine-learning techniques to solve complex problems and make data-driven decisions. 
  2. Career Opportunities: With the high demand for machine learning professionals comes a plethora of career opportunities. Jobs in the field of machine learning are high-paying, challenging, and provide room for growth and development. 
  3. Real-World Applications: Machine learning has numerous real-world applications, ranging from fraud detection and risk analysis to personalized advertising and natural language processing. As more people become aware of the practical applications of machine learning, their interest in learning more about the technology grows. 
  4. Advancements in Technology: With the advances in technology, access to machine learning tools has become easier than ever. There are numerous open-source machine-learning tools and libraries available that make it easy for anyone to get started with machine learning. 
  5. Intellectual Stimulation: Learning about machine learning can be an intellectually stimulating experience. Machine learning involves the study of complex algorithms and models that can make sense of large amounts of data.
